Assume the marginal product of robots is 10,000 and the price of a robot is $1,000, while the marginal product of labor is 90 and the price of labor is $9. What should the firm do? (A) Increase the amount of capital and decrease labor so the marginal product of robots increases and the marginal product of labor increases (B) Decrease the amount of capital and decrease labor so the marginal product of robots increases and the marginal product of labor decreases (C) Decrease the amount of capital and increase labor so the marginal product of robots decreases and the marginal product of labor increases (D) Increase the amount of capital and increase labor so the marginal product of robots increases and the marginal product of labor increases (E) Increase the amount of capital and decrease labor so the marginal product of robots decreases and the marginal product of labor increases

Step 1
For robots, it's 10,000/1,000 = 10 units per dollar. For labor, it's 90/9 = 10 units per dollar. Since the marginal product per dollar is the same for both robots and labor, the firm is currently optimizing its resources. Show more…
